Build in Motion is a custom software engineering and cloud computing company founded in 2012 and headquartered in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ania, USA. It is not a developer tool or SaaS platform in the traditional sense, but rather a company that provides project-based software development, consulting, and technical delivery services for businesses. Its services cover mobile apps, web software, AI, e-commerce, IoT/smart home, website development, DevOps, and cloud infrastructure.
Based on the website, Build in Motion’s core value lies in end-to-end project delivery. In the early Discovery phase, it helps validate concepts, assess feasibility, and define security and scalability roadmaps. During the design phase, it provides wireframes, prototypes, usability metrics, and cross-platform experiences. In the development phase, it emphasizes the integration of engineering and QA, continuous delivery, automated testing, and post-launch enhancements. Its technology stack includes AWS, Microsoft .NET, iOS, Android, React Native, Java, ReactJS, Angular, NodeJS, PHP, Sitecore, and WordPress, making it suitable for building multi-platform business systems.
The website does not disclose standard pricing, packages, hourly rates, or maintenance fees. It only provides a “Get a Quote” option for requesting a proposal. Therefore, it can be inferred that Build in Motion primarily uses a custom project-based pricing model, with actual costs depending on the scope of requirements, technical complexity, delivery timeline, and ongoing support.
Its strengths include a broad service scope covering the full lifecycle from discovery and design to development, testing, DevOps, and post-launch improvements. It also has supporting customer testimonials, with case studies involving POS systems, energy project dashboards, special education applications, sales tools, and website design. Its staff augmentation services are also suitable for companies that need to temporarily supplement their development resources.
The main drawback is limited transparency. The site lacks information on team size, SLAs, detailed delivery methodology, price ranges, and in-depth technical case studies. Some service descriptions, such as those for AI and e-commerce, are relatively generic, making it difficult to assess the company’s depth in specific vertical industries. For users looking for a developer platform, API, or open-source tool that can be directly signed up for and used, Build in Motion is not a good fit.
Build in Motion is best suited for small and medium-sized businesses and organizations in the U.S. or English-speaking environments that need outsourced custom software development, cloud migration, DevOps transformation, IoT applications, or mobile/web products. Access from China is not addressed in the provided text, so it is not possible to confirm whether the site can be accessed directly. For cross-border cooperation, it would also be necessary to confirm communication time zones, contracts, payment methods, and data compliance requirements.
